DEPUTY HEAD OF SOLAR ENGINEERING

JOB DESCRIPTION

  • Coordinate and supervise the technical implementation of solar power projects – from site survey, design, equipment selection, technical drawings, and quantity take-off to construction – ensuring performance, quality, and investment efficiency.
  • Assign tasks, supervise progress, and provide technical guidance to design and implementation engineers; train and mentor team members.
  • Work directly with partners and clients to consult, present, and defend design proposals, technical solutions, and relevant documentation.
  • Collaborate with relevant departments (Tendering, Procurement, Construction, etc.) to ensure consistency in design, construction, and as-built documentation.
  • Monitor the progress of design work, supervise quality, and control technical costs thro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Support the Tendering Department with technical inputs, including the preparation and explanation of design concepts in bids and technical documentation.
  • Participate in technical meetings with partners, contractors, and clients; coordinate to resolve issues arising during implementation.
  • Propose and oversee the implementation of internal design standards, technical procedures, and workflows to ensure quality, safety, and cost optimization.
  • Keep up to date with emerging technologies and technical standards; recommend advanced design solutions aligned with renewable energy industry trends.
  • Advise the Head of Technical Department on technical strategy, team capacity development, and process improvement.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Head of Department or the Board of Directors.

JOB REQUIREMENTS:

– Must-Have Qualifications

– Education: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Automation, Electronics, Mechatronics, or related technical fields.

– Professional Experience & Skills:

  • Minimum 3 years of experience in a similar position.
  • Solid knowledge of solar power systems: Off-grid, Hybrid, On-grid, BESS.
  • Strong understanding of PV modules (structure, classification, operation).
  • Strong understanding of PV inverters (types, operation).
  • Good knowledge of technical standards and regulations in the electrical/solar industry.
  • Proficient in AutoCAD, SketchUp, PVSyst for design and technical analysis.
  • Solid knowledge of testing devices and measurement methods for system components.
  • Experience in using and managing monitoring systems from major manufacturers (Huawei, Sungrow, SMA, etc.).
  • Strong team management, training, and coaching skills.
  • Excellent communication, technical negotiation, and problem-solving skills.
  • Willing to travel and manage mult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Good English communication skills, with the ability to read and understand technical documents

– Nice-to-Have Qualifications

  • Ability to design, calculate, and prepare BOM (Bill of Materials) for solar projects ≥ 1MWp.
